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
Our team will conduct a thorough inspection of your office building to identify the source and extent of the water damage.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and assess the damage. Don’t wait – call us today to schedule your inspection and get started on the road to recovery.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Using specialized equipment such as truck-mounted extractors and wet vacuums, our technicians will extract the water from your office building. We’ll work quickly and efficiently to reduce downtime and prevent further damage. We’ll be there in no time to get the water out and start the drying process.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water has been extracted, our team will focus on drying and dehumidifying your office building to prevent mold growth and further damage. We’ll use specialized equipment such as dehumidifiers and air movers to speed up the drying process. We’ll work around the clock to ensure that your property is completely dry and safe to occupy.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
After the drying process is complete, our team will thoroughly clean and sanitize your office building to prevent the growth of mold and bacteria. We’ll use specialized equipment and cleaning solutions to ensure that your property is completely clean and safe to occupy. We’ll leave your office building smelling fresh and clean!

Office Building Water Extraction Cost in Middleton, TN
The cost of office building water extraction in Middleton, TN can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ide you with a free estimate and work with you to develop a customized plan that meets your budget and needs. We’ll work with you to ensure that you get the best possible service at a price you can afford.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, local conditions |
| Drying and d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, local conditions |
| Cleaning and s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, local conditions |
